About This Item
Urbana, Illinois: Univ of Illinois Press, 2003. Book. Very Good+. Hardcover. Signed by Author(s). Revised and Updated. First edition, first printing as evidenced by a complete number line from 1 to 5; inscribed by Marian McPartland on front end paper: " To __, All the best, Marian McPartland"; also appears to be signed on the half-title page with no inscription; minor edge wear; otherwise a solid, clean copy in collectible condition..
